The North West Dragons are desperate for silverware and see the upcoming CSA One-Day Cup as a golden opportunity to achieve this.
Over the past few seasons, the team from Potchefstroom has come agonisingly close and they want to go one step further in the 50-over competition.
First up for the Dragons will be a Central South African derby against the Knights at home on the weekend.
The Dragons batter, Lesiba Ngoepe, told OFM Sport that they have their goals, but the Free State cannot be underestimated
